Trocaire vs. Temple Cost Comparison

Which college is more expensive, Trocaire or Temple? Published tuition is the sticker price; many students pay less after aid (see average net price below).

  • The typical actual cost that students pay to attend (average net price) is less at Trocaire College than Temple ($16,953 vs. $28,088).
  • Living costs (room and board or off-campus housing budget) at Trocaire College are 9.6% lower than at Temple University ($16,000 vs. $17,690).
  • Temple University is 11.5% more expensive for in-state tuition than Trocaire (about $2,371 more per year; $23,011.00 vs. $20,640.00).
  • Out-of-state tuition is 88.8% higher at Temple than at Trocaire College (about $18,318 more per year; $38,958.00 vs. $20,640.00).
  • A larger share of students receive grant aid at Trocaire College than at Temple University (98% vs. 89%).
  • The average total grant financial aid received by Temple University students is 16.9% larger than aid received by Trocaire College students ($14,837 vs. $12,687).

Trocaire vs. Temple Graduation Outcomes Comparison

How do outcomes compare for Trocaire and Temple? Graduation rate, earnings, and student loan debt are common indicators. The bullets below summarize the same federal outcomes fields as the comparison table (College Scorecard / IPEDS where applicable).

  • Graduates from Temple University earn a median of about $16,100 more per year than Trocaire graduates about ten years after starting college ($56,300 vs. $40,200), per the same Scorecard earnings definition.
  • Among federal student loan borrowers, Trocaire College graduates have a $5,000 lower median loan debt than Temple graduates ($21,000 vs. $26,000).
  • Among borrowers, Trocaire graduates have an estimated $51 lower median monthly federal student loan payment than Temple graduates ($217 vs. $268).
  • More Temple graduates are actively paying back their federal student loan debt than former Trocaire students, three years after graduation. (69% vs. 45%)
